The vulnerability exists due to improper input validation where the application uses the client-supplied 'Origin' HTTP header to construct the base URL for password-reset links sent via email.\u003c/p\u003e\n\u003cp\u003eAn unauthenticated attacker can exploit this by initiating a password-reset request for a target user account while simultaneously providing a crafted 'Origin' header in the HTTP request. The SOGo backend fails to sanitize this input, resulting in the generation of a legitimate reset token delivered to the user, but embedded within a URL pointing to an attacker-controlled server. If the victim clicks this link, the recovery token is leaked to the attacker's server, facilitating full account takeover.
